Chocolate Madeleines ๐Ÿซ

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 20 minutes
Total Time: 35 minutes
Yield: 36 madeleines

Madeleines are those delightful, shell-shaped cakes that are perfect for any time of the day, anywhere you may be. But have you tried the chocolate version? ๐Ÿซโœจ Guaranteed to please even the most discerning sweet tooth, these chocolate madeleines are a heavenly treat that pairs wonderfully with a steaming cup of coffee or a fragrant cup of tea.

Ingredients:

Amount Ingredient
3/4 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 cup sugar
4 large eggs
1 cup unsalted butter
12 tablespoons cocoa powder

Instructions:

  1. Preheat and Prepare:

    • Preheat your oven to 425 degrees Fahrenheit (220 degrees Celsius).
    • Grease your madeleine pans generously with butter using a pastry brush.
  2. Sift Dry Ingredients:

    • In a medium bowl, sift together the all-purpose flour, cocoa powder, and salt. Set this dry mixture aside.
  3. Whisk Eggs and Sugar:

    • In a large mixing bowl or the bowl of your electric mixer, combine the eggs and sugar.
    • Whisk vigorously until the mixture becomes thick and takes on a lovely, lemon-colored hue.
  4. Fold in Dry Ingredients:

    • Gently fold the sifted dry ingredients into the egg and sugar mixture.
    • Be careful not to overmix; you want a light and airy batter.
  5. Melt and Add Butter:

    • In a small saucepan, melt the unsalted butter over low heat.
    • Once melted, let it cool slightly before adding it to the batter.
    • Gently fold the melted butter into the batter until just combined.
  6. Fill Madeleine Pans:

    • Spoon the batter into the prepared madeleine pans, filling each mold about 3/4 full.
    • Smooth out the tops gently with a spatula.
  7. Chill the Batter:

    • Place the filled madeleine pans in the refrigerator along with any remaining batter.
    • Let them chill for at least one hour. This helps the madeleines form those lovely little humps.
  8. Bake the Madeleines:

    • Once chilled, place the madeleine pans in the preheated oven.
    • Bake for about 7 minutes or until the madeleines are firm to the touch and slightly puffed.
    • You can bake in batches if needed, ensuring the pans are cooled before refilling.
  9. Serve and Enjoy:

    • As soon as the madeleines are done, remove them from the oven.
    • Immediately turn them out of the molds onto a wire rack to cool completely.
    • Once cooled, these chocolate madeleines are best enjoyed slightly warm or at room temperature.
  10. Storage Tip:

    • Store any leftover madeleines in an airtight container at room temperature.
    • They are best eaten within a day or two, though we doubt they’ll last that long!
